DEB'S TOP THREE: SPRUCING UP THE BEDROOM

Jordan August 5, 2015

I love small, unique accessories around the house. In a bathroom, you can incorporate some interesting décor items too.

1. Old bottles: antique medicine bottles have that old fashioned pharmacy look. I love the old blue bottles in the window. These are usually easy to find at flea markets or antique stores and you can also use them as small vases.

bathroom window

2. A large jar of shells. So simple and easy to showcase shells in a glass jar. In my case I have a lot of them, but even a few shells in a jar in the bathroom give it some sea side charm.

bathrom 2

3. A fringed hand towel. I like a fringed hand towel over the sink because it has a relaxed look. This one sits on top of a couple of other towels and is personalized with a “D” on it!

WATERWORKS KITCHEN & BATH

Deborah Nelson February 16, 2015

When I was recently in NYC I spent some time at the Waterworks showroom. Their products are beautiful and have a classic, timeless look. They do an un-lacquered brass finish that starts off as quite a regular looking brass but quickly ages into a gorgeous patina. Here is an un-lacquered brass faucet "new" and "after" one had been in the showroom for awhile. The Waterworks line is expensive, but they have an online shop that offers some great looking pieces at more affordable prices.

PEDESTAL SINKS & STORAGE IDEAS

Deborah Nelson January 14, 2015

Pedestal sinks might not be great for storage, but they make up for it in charm and character. I was happy I could re-use the original pedestal sink in my renovated and relocated bathroom (above). This one is quite old and very large, which makes it even more unique. Here are a couple of other bathrooms with pedestal sinks that also show where you can add some storage. You can add a large medicine cabinet on the wall, or even a bureau for all your storage requirements.

BEFORE & AFTER: BATHROOM GETS A MUCH NEEDED RENO

Deborah Nelson November 5, 2014

This bathroom got a much needed makeover. Here's a BEFORE picture:

Before 1 with plans

The plans were to replace everything in this bathroom.The room was opened right to the studs to do the proper wiring for the fan and lighting. The updates included: a new white hex tile floor, new drywall/paint/trim, new tub/shower, new toilet, new sink/faucet, new light fixture, new medicine cabinet inset into the wall and all the other small accessories like towel bar and a bit of artwork.
